Find g(a - 1) when g(x) = 5x - 4.

Answer:

[tex]g(a-1) = 5a-9[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

Hi there!

[tex]g(x) = 5x - 4[/tex]

Replace all x's with a-1:

[tex]g(a-1) = 5(a-1) - 4\\g(a-1) = 5a-5 - 4\\g(a-1) = 5a-9[/tex]
